Skip to content

Commit 091544d

Browse files
committed
release: v1.9.7
1 parent 570d29c commit 091544d

9 files changed

Lines changed: 19 additions & 25 deletions

File tree

package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
{
22
"name": "create-mettle-app",
3-
"version": "1.9.5",
3+
"version": "1.9.7",
44
"license": "MIT",
55
"author": "maomincoding",
66
"bin": {

template-mettle-apps-ts/package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@
1010
"devDependencies": {
1111
"typescript": "~5.7.2",
1212
"vite": "^6.1.0",
13-
"vite-plugin-mettle": "^1.8.1"
13+
"vite-plugin-mettle": "^1.9.0"
1414
},
1515
"dependencies": {
1616
"mettle": "^1.8.3",

template-mettle-apps-ts/src/views/home.tsx

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,7 @@
1-
import { signal } from 'mettle';
21
import { linkTo } from 'mettle-router';
32

43
export default function Home() {
5-
const msg = signal('hello');
4+
let msg = $signal('hello');
65

76
function goAbout() {
87
linkTo({
@@ -15,14 +14,14 @@ export default function Home() {
1514
}
1615

1716
function useChange() {
18-
msg.value = 'world';
17+
msg = 'world';
1918
}
2019

2120
return (
2221
<>
2322
<button onClick={goAbout}>goAbout</button>
2423
<h1>Home</h1>
25-
<p onClick={useChange}>{msg.value}</p>
24+
<p onClick={useChange}>{msg}</p>
2625
</>
2726
);
2827
}

template-mettle-apps/package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@
99
},
1010
"devDependencies": {
1111
"vite": "^6.1.0",
12-
"vite-plugin-mettle": "^1.8.1"
12+
"vite-plugin-mettle": "^1.9.0"
1313
},
1414
"dependencies": {
1515
"mettle": "^1.8.3",

template-mettle-apps/src/views/home.jsx

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,7 @@
1-
import { signal } from 'mettle';
21
import { linkTo } from 'mettle-router';
32

43
export default function Home() {
5-
const msg = signal('hello');
4+
let msg = $signal('hello');
65

76
function goAbout() {
87
linkTo({
@@ -15,14 +14,14 @@ export default function Home() {
1514
}
1615

1716
function useChange() {
18-
msg.value = 'world';
17+
msg = 'world';
1918
}
2019

2120
return (
2221
<>
2322
<button onClick={goAbout}>goAbout</button>
2423
<h1>Home</h1>
25-
<p onClick={useChange}>{msg.value}</p>
24+
<p onClick={useChange}>{msg}</p>
2625
</>
2726
);
2827
}

template-mettle-ts/package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@
1010
"devDependencies": {
1111
"typescript": "~5.7.2",
1212
"vite": "^6.1.0",
13-
"vite-plugin-mettle": "^1.8.1"
13+
"vite-plugin-mettle": "^1.9.0"
1414
},
1515
"dependencies": {
1616
"mettle": "^1.8.3"
Lines changed: 4 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-1,16 +1,14 @@
1-
import { signal } from 'mettle';
2-
31
export default function Home() {
4-
const count: any = signal(0);
2+
let count: any = $signal(0);
53

64
function add() {
7-
count.value++;
5+
count++;
86
}
97
return (
108
<>
119
<button onClick={add}>Add</button>
12-
<h1>{count.value}</h1>
13-
<input value={count.value} />
10+
<h1>{count}</h1>
11+
<input value={count} />
1412
</>
1513
);
1614
}

template-mettle/package.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@
99
},
1010
"devDependencies": {
1111
"vite": "^6.1.0",
12-
"vite-plugin-mettle": "^1.8.1"
12+
"vite-plugin-mettle": "^1.9.0"
1313
},
1414
"dependencies": {
1515
"mettle": "^1.8.3"

template-mettle/src/views/home.jsx

Lines changed: 4 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-1,16 +1,14 @@
1-
import { signal } from 'mettle';
2-
31
export default function Home() {
4-
const count = signal(0);
2+
let count = $signal(0);
53

64
function add() {
7-
count.value++;
5+
count++;
86
}
97
return (
108
<>
119
<button onClick={add}>Add</button>
12-
<h1>{count.value}</h1>
13-
<input value={count.value} />
10+
<h1>{count}</h1>
11+
<input value={count} />
1412
</>
1513
);
1614
}

0 commit comments

Comments
 (0)